Introducing G2.ai, the future of software buying.Try now
Produkt-Avatar-Bild

JUnit

Bewertungsdetails anzeigen
39 Bewertungen
  • 1 Profile
  • 1 Kategorien
Durchschnittliche Sternebewertung
4.2
Betreut Kunden seit
Profilfilter

Alle Produkte & Dienstleistungen

Produkt-Avatar-Bild
JUnit

39 Bewertungen

JUnit ist ein Open-Source-Testframework für Java, das entwickelt wurde, um die Erstellung und Ausführung wiederholbarer Tests zu erleichtern. Entwickelt von Kent Beck und Erich Gamma, hat es sich zu einem Standardwerkzeug in der Java-Entwicklung entwickelt, das es Entwicklern ermöglicht, Unit-Tests zu schreiben und auszuführen, die überprüfen, ob einzelne Komponenten des Codes wie beabsichtigt funktionieren. Hauptmerkmale und Funktionalität: - Annotations: Vereinfacht das Schreiben von Tests mit Annotations wie `@Test`, `@BeforeEach` und `@AfterEach`, um Testmethoden und Setup/Teardown-Prozeduren zu definieren. - Assertions: Bietet eine Reihe von Assertions-Methoden, um erwartete und tatsächliche Ergebnisse zu vergleichen und sicherzustellen, dass der Code wie erwartet funktioniert. - Test Runners: Unterstützt verschiedene Test Runners, um Tests auszuführen und Ergebnisse zu berichten, einschließlich der Integration mit Build-Tools wie Maven und Gradle. - Parameterized Tests: Ermöglicht das Ausführen desselben Tests mit unterschiedlichen Eingaben, um die Testabdeckung zu verbessern. - Integration mit IDEs: Integriert sich nahtlos in beliebte integrierte Entwicklungsumgebungen (IDEs) wie IntelliJ IDEA und Eclipse und bietet eine benutzerfreundliche Oberfläche für die Testausführung und Ergebnisanalyse. Primärer Wert und gelöstes Problem: JUnit adressiert das Bedürfnis nach zuverlässigem und effizientem Unit-Testing in Java-Anwendungen. Durch die Automatisierung des Testprozesses hilft es Entwicklern, Fehler früh im Entwicklungszyklus zu identifizieren und zu beheben, was zu höherer Codequalität und Wartbarkeit führt. Die Integration mit verschiedenen Tools und Frameworks rationalisiert den Entwicklungsworkflow und macht es zu einem wesentlichen Bestandteil moderner Java-Entwicklungspraxis.

Profilname

Sternebewertung

18
19
1
1
0

JUnit Bewertungen

Bewertungsfilter
Profilname
Sternebewertung
18
19
1
1
0
Verifizierter Benutzer in Bankwesen
BB
Verifizierter Benutzer in Bankwesen
01/15/2026
Bestätigter Bewerter
Bewertungsquelle: Organische Bewertung aus dem Benutzerprofil
Übersetzt mit KI

White- und Black-Box-Tests in einem leistungsstarken Framework

Es bietet sowohl White-Box- als auch Black-Box-Tests innerhalb eines einzigen Rahmens.
Verifizierter Benutzer in Informationstechnologie und Dienstleistungen
BI
Verifizierter Benutzer in Informationstechnologie und Dienstleistungen
09/19/2025
Bestätigter Bewerter
Bewertungsquelle: G2-Einladung
Anreizbasierte Bewertung
Übersetzt mit KI

JUnit verbessert die Konsistenz und minimiert das Risiko von Fehlern.

JUnit ist äußerst vielseitig und unterstützt alles von präzisen Unit-Tests bis hin zu umfassenderen Integrationstests. Es ermöglicht die gleichzeitige Ausführung für schnellere Rückmeldungen, und seine integrierte Berichterstattung macht das Dokumentieren und Teilen von Ergebnissen mit dem Team klar und zuverlässig.
Vishal T.
VT
Vishal T.
08/01/2025
Bestätigter Bewerter
Verifizierter aktueller Benutzer
Bewertungsquelle: G2-Einladung
Anreizbasierte Bewertung
Übersetzt mit KI

JUnit: Das Rückgrat des Java-Unit-Tests

JUnit bietet eine saubere und einfache API zum Schreiben und Organisieren von Tests, was es leicht verständlich und wartbar macht.

Über

Kontakt

Hauptsitz:
Oslo, Oslo

Sozial

@junit

Was ist JUnit?

JUnit is a widely-used open-source framework for writing and running tests in the Java programming language. It is designed to help developers ensure code quality and reliability by facilitating a streamlined, standardized testing process. JUnit provides annotations, assertions, and test runners, allowing developers to write and manage repeatable automated tests. It is an integral part of the test-driven development (TDD) approach. JUnit is highly extensible, supporting seamless integration with a variety of development environments and build tools, including popular IDEs and CI/CD systems.

Details

Webseite
junit.org